VIRGINIA BEACH

Police announced today the arrest of one of three men suspected of robbing 10 people and sexually assaulting two women during a home invasion in September.

Richard “Richie” Richardson Jr., 19, of Virginia Beach, was charged with 90 felonies stemming from the Sept. 10 incident and a Sept. 7 street robbery, police spokeswoman Margie Long said.

Police say that about 10:55 p.m. Sept. 10, Richardson and two other men carried a handgun, rifle and shotgun as they forced their way into a unit at Pembroke Lake Apartments, in the 4700 block of Windermere Court. One man was punched in the face, two women were raped and a teenager who came to the door during the robbery was chased and shot outside the building. The teen survived.

The intruders escaped in a vehicle described as a brown and tan Pontiac Bonneville. A fourth person may have been a getaway driver, Long said.

In addition to the 84 counts related to the Pembroke Lakes Apartment, Richardson was charged with robbing two people at gunpoint on Sept. 7, Long said.

Richardson made an initial appearance in General District Court via closed circuit video. A date of Dec. 9 was set to determine who would represent him.

Police still are looking for two other men who took part in the home invasion. One was described as 18 to 21 years old, about 5 feet 10 inches tall and 240 pounds, with a small Afro and wearing a white T-shirt and blue jeans. The other was of unknown age, about 6 feet tall, and 165 to 190 pounds. He wore a stocking mask.
